It'd be interesting to see how well the keyboard holds up after a few months of use. I'm glad you enjoy it. I know this was mentioned in the review but I feel it needs to be stressed that the keys are really, really loud compared to membrane or the cherry browns.

I'm not sure why Razer would choose to go with the blues over the browns since blues can have a problem with not registering a double tap due to the release point being above the operating point:
[image loading]
While the browns don't have this issue:
[image loading]

Not too big of a deal since starcraft doesn't demand as much rapid double tapping as Unreal or stepmania ect...
